news 2026/5/6 17:46:29

Upscayl完全指南:5步掌握免费AI图像放大终极技巧

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Upscayl完全指南:5步掌握免费AI图像放大终极技巧

Upscayl完全指南:5步掌握免费AI图像放大终极技巧

【免费下载链接】upscayl🆙 Upscayl - #1 Free and Open Source AI Image Upscaler for Linux, MacOS and Windows.项目地址: https://gitcode.com/GitHub_Trending/up/upscayl

还在为模糊的照片、低分辨率的截图或细节缺失的数字图像而烦恼吗?Upscayl作为一款完全免费且开源的AI图像放大工具,通过先进的深度学习算法智能地将低质量图片转换为高清版本。这款跨平台解决方案支持Windows、macOS和Linux系统,让普通用户也能轻松实现专业级的图像增强效果。

传统图像放大的困境与AI解决方案

在数字图像处理领域,传统放大方法面临诸多挑战。简单的像素拉伸会导致图像模糊失真,而昂贵的商业软件又让普通用户望而却步。Upscayl基于Real-ESRGAN技术,采用深度神经网络智能重建图像细节,不仅增加像素数量,更提升图像内容质量。

传统方法的三大局限

  1. 像素化问题:传统插值方法导致图像边缘锯齿化
  2. 细节丢失:放大过程中高频细节信息无法恢复
  3. 成本高昂:专业图像处理软件价格昂贵且功能复杂

AI超分辨率的突破

Upscayl利用Vulkan图形API实现GPU加速,将处理速度提升数十倍,同时保持图像质量。这种基于深度学习的超分辨率技术能够智能"想象"并重建缺失的细节,实现真正的图像质量提升。

架构设计与技术优势全景解析

核心技术架构

Upscayl采用模块化设计,前端基于Electron框架构建跨平台桌面应用,后端集成NCNN推理引擎,支持多种AI模型格式。这种架构确保了应用的稳定性和扩展性。

技术优势对比分析

特性Upscayl传统软件其他AI工具
开源免费✅ 完全开源❌ 通常付费❌ 多数收费
跨平台支持✅ Windows/macOS/Linux⚠️ 平台限制⚠️ 平台限制
GPU加速✅ Vulkan支持❌ 依赖CPU⚠️ 部分支持
模型定制✅ 支持自定义❌ 固定算法⚠️ 有限定制
批量处理✅ 内置支持⚠️ 基础功能⚠️ 部分支持
离线使用✅ 完全离线⚠️ 部分离线❌ 需要云端

决策流程图:如何选择最适合的配置

实战应用:从零开始的高效工作流

环境准备与快速安装

Windows用户安装指南

  1. 访问项目发布页面下载最新安装包
  2. 双击运行安装程序,按向导完成安装
  3. 如遇系统安全提示,选择"更多信息"→"仍要运行"

macOS用户安装方法

  1. 从官方网站或App Store获取安装包
  2. 将Upscayl图标拖拽到应用程序文件夹
  3. 首次运行时在Finder中右键点击选择"打开"

Linux用户多种选择

  • Flatpak安装:flatpak install flathub org.upscayl.Upscayl
  • AppImage便携版本,无需安装即可运行
  • 各发行版的软件中心直接安装

核心功能配置详解

界面布局与操作流程Upscayl采用直观的四步操作界面,左侧为功能面板,右侧为图像预览区域。这种设计让用户能够快速上手,无需复杂的学习过程。

步骤1:图像选择与预处理点击"SELECT IMAGE"按钮选择源文件,支持JPG、PNG、WEBP等主流格式。建议在处理前:

  • 检查图像格式兼容性
  • 确认图像分辨率不低于100×100像素
  • 备份原始文件以防意外覆盖

步骤2:模型选择策略根据图像类型选择最合适的AI模型:

  • RealESRGAN Standard:通用照片、风景图像
  • RealESRGAN AnimeVideo:动漫、插画作品
  • Ultrasharp:建筑、文字图像,边缘锐化效果显著
  • High Fidelity:人像摄影、艺术品,细腻质感还原

步骤3:参数优化配置

  • 放大倍数:提供2倍、3倍、4倍等多种选择
  • 输出格式:保持原始格式或转换为其他格式
  • 压缩率:平衡文件大小与图像质量

步骤4:处理与输出管理点击"UPSCAYL"按钮启动处理,进度条实时显示状态。处理完成后,软件会自动打开输出文件夹,方便立即查看结果。

高级特性深度探索

GPU加速优化配置当系统配备多个显卡时,可以手动指定用于AI处理的GPU设备:

  1. 打开设置面板(界面右上角齿轮图标)
  2. 在"GPU ID"输入框中填写设备编号(通常0表示主显卡)
  3. 多GPU系统可输入逗号分隔的ID列表,如"0,1"

自定义模型导入方法Upscayl支持加载第三方NCNN格式模型,扩展处理能力:

  1. 创建专门的"models"文件夹
  2. 将下载的.bin和.param模型文件放入该文件夹
  3. 在设置中选择"Select Custom Models Folder"
  4. 新模型会自动出现在选择列表中

批量处理高效工作流对于需要处理大量图像的用户,Upscayl提供批量处理功能:

  • 选择包含多个图像的文件夹
  • 启用"Batch Upscale"选项
  • 软件会自动按顺序处理所有图像
  • 处理进度实时显示,可随时暂停或停止

效果验证:实际应用案例与性能基准

图像增强效果对比展示

标准模型风景放大效果经过Upscayl标准模型4倍放大处理后的金门大桥场景,画面细节(如桥梁结构、山体纹理)更加清晰,色彩过渡自然,细节增强明显。

工业场景超锐化处理使用Ultrasharp模型处理工业场景,图像边缘(如建筑轮廓、管道结构)更加锐利,细节(如文字标识、设备纹理)更加清晰,整体风格偏"锐化增强"。

性能基准测试结果

处理速度对比表| 图像分辨率 | 2倍放大耗时 | 4倍放大耗时 | GPU内存占用 | |-----------|------------|------------|------------| | 500×500像素 | 2-3秒 | 5-7秒 | 1-2GB | | 1000×1000像素 | 5-8秒 | 12-18秒 | 2-4GB | | 2000×2000像素 | 15-25秒 | 30-45秒 | 4-8GB |

质量评估指标

  • PSNR值提升:平均提升8-12dB
  • SSIM相似度:保持在0.85-0.95之间
  • 细节保留率:高频细节保留率超过90%

用户故事:实际应用场景

案例一:历史照片修复张先生有一张50年前的家庭老照片,分辨率仅为300×400像素。使用Upscayl的High Fidelity模型进行4倍放大后,照片中人物的面部特征、服装纹理都得到了清晰还原,成功打印成8寸照片用于家庭相册。

案例二:游戏截图增强游戏主播李小姐需要将游戏截图用于视频封面,但原始截图分辨率不足。使用RealESRGAN AnimeVideo模型处理后,图像细节更加丰富,色彩更加鲜艳,完美满足高清封面需求。

案例三:设计素材优化平面设计师王先生需要将低分辨率的网络素材用于印刷品设计。通过Upscayl的Ultrasharp模型处理,图像边缘更加清晰,避免了印刷时的模糊问题。

调优建议与故障排除指南

性能优化技巧

硬件配置建议

  • GPU选择:推荐NVIDIA RTX系列或AMD Radeon RX系列显卡
  • 内存要求:至少8GB系统内存,建议16GB以上
  • 存储空间:预留足够的磁盘空间存储处理结果

软件设置优化

  • 关闭不必要的后台程序释放系统资源
  • 定期清理临时文件和缓存
  • 确保显卡驱动程序为最新版本

常见问题快速解决参考表

问题现象可能原因解决方案
程序无法启动Vulkan兼容性问题更新显卡驱动,确认GPU支持Vulkan 1.1+
处理速度慢GPU未正确识别在设置中指定正确的GPU ID
输出质量不佳模型选择不当根据图像类型重新选择合适模型
内存不足错误图像分辨率过高降低放大倍数或分批处理
输出文件损坏磁盘空间不足清理磁盘空间,确保有足够存储

最佳实践分享

图像预处理建议

  1. 格式转换:将图像转换为PNG格式可避免JPEG压缩损失
  2. 分辨率检查:确保原始图像分辨率不低于100×100像素
  3. 色彩模式:使用RGB色彩模式获得最佳处理效果
  4. 文件备份:处理前备份原始文件,防止意外覆盖

工作流程优化

  • 建立项目文件夹:按项目分类管理原始图像和处理结果
  • 使用模板设置:为常用处理类型保存参数模板
  • 定期清理缓存:删除临时文件释放磁盘空间
  • 版本控制:对重要图像处理结果进行版本管理

质量与速度平衡策略

  • 4倍放大:适合细节丰富的图像,处理时间相对较长
  • 2倍放大:处理速度快,适合快速预览效果
  • 批量处理:夜间或空闲时间处理大量图像
  • 预览功能:先处理小样图确认效果,再处理完整图像

生态建设与未来发展展望

社区贡献指南

作为开源项目,Upscayl欢迎社区贡献:

  • 模型开发:用户可以训练和贡献新的AI模型
  • 功能扩展:开发者可以添加新功能或改进现有功能
  • 本地化支持:帮助翻译软件界面到更多语言
  • 文档完善:改进使用指南和故障排除文档

扩展开发建议

自定义模型开发

  1. 学习Real-ESRGAN模型训练方法
  2. 准备高质量的训练数据集
  3. 使用NCNN工具链转换模型格式
  4. 在Upscayl中测试和优化模型性能

插件系统规划

  • 图像预处理插件:自动调整亮度、对比度等参数
  • 批量处理插件:支持复杂的批量操作流程
  • 输出格式插件:扩展支持的输出格式类型
  • 云服务集成:与云存储服务无缝集成

技术发展趋势

AI算法演进方向

  • 更高效的神经网络架构
  • 更准确的内容感知重建
  • 更快的推理速度优化
  • 更低的硬件资源需求

应用场景扩展

  • 视频超分辨率处理
  • 实时图像增强
  • 移动端应用适配
  • 专业摄影工作流集成

总结:开启高质量图像处理新时代

Upscayl不仅是一款功能强大的AI图像放大工具,更代表了开源软件在人工智能应用领域的成功实践。通过简单直观的操作界面、强大的处理能力和完全免费的授权模式,它让专业级的图像增强技术变得触手可及。

无论你是摄影爱好者需要修复老照片,设计师需要放大素材图像,还是普通用户想要提升社交媒体图片质量,Upscayl都能提供出色的解决方案。其跨平台特性和开源本质确保了长期的技术支持和功能更新。

现在就开始使用Upscayl,体验AI技术带来的图像质量革命。记住,高质量的图像处理不再是专业人士的专属工具,通过这款开源神器,每个人都能成为自己图像的魔法师。

提示:对于最佳使用体验,建议先从2倍放大开始测试效果,逐步调整参数至满意结果。处理高分辨率图像时,确保系统有足够的内存和存储空间。

【免费下载链接】upscayl🆙 Upscayl - #1 Free and Open Source AI Image Upscaler for Linux, MacOS and Windows.项目地址: https://gitcode.com/GitHub_Trending/up/upscayl

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/6 17:40:47

Draw.io隐藏技巧:用Mermaid画时序图,比Visio和PPT快10倍

Draw.io与Mermaid时序图:工程师的高效可视化利器 在技术方案评审会上,你是否经历过这样的场景:当讨论到复杂的微服务调用链时,白板上密密麻麻的箭头让所有人陷入困惑;或是故障复盘时,手工绘制的时序图因为一…

作者头像 李华
网站建设 2026/5/6 17:38:44

面试官问基数排序,除了LSD你还能聊MSD吗?从场景到代码的深度对比

基数排序双视角解析:LSD与MSD的工程实践选择 当面试官用"除了LSD还能聊MSD吗"这个问题打断你的算法陈述时,实际上在考察三个维度:对算法本质的理解深度、实际场景的适配能力,以及工程实现的权衡意识。作为经历过Google…

作者头像 李华
网站建设 2026/5/6 17:35:28

任天堂Switch屏幕色彩优化完整指南:快速提升游戏视觉体验

任天堂Switch屏幕色彩优化完整指南:快速提升游戏视觉体验 【免费下载链接】Fizeau Color management on the Nintendo Switch 项目地址: https://gitcode.com/gh_mirrors/fi/Fizeau 还在为Switch屏幕色彩平淡而烦恼吗?想要让你的游戏画面更加生动…

作者头像 李华
网站建设 2026/5/6 17:29:30

构建健壮插件生态:BepInEx框架的架构哲学与实践

构建健壮插件生态:BepInEx框架的架构哲学与实践 【免费下载链接】BepInEx Unity / XNA game patcher and plugin framework 项目地址: https://gitcode.com/GitHub_Trending/be/BepInEx 在Unity游戏开发领域,插件框架的设计往往决定了整个Mod生态…

作者头像 李华